Conceptual Framework for New Science Education Standards - 0 views

  •  
    "What is the framework? A Framework for K-12 Science Education identifies the key scientific practices, concepts and ideas that all students should learn by the time they complete high school. It is intended as a guide for those who develop science education standards, those who design curricula and assessments, and others who work in K-12 science education."

achievethecore.org / Steal These Tools / Close Reading Exemplars - 0 views

  •  
    "To be college and career ready, students need to be able to read sufficiently complex texts on their own and gather evidence, knowledge, and insight from those texts. These close reading exemplars intend to model how teachers can support their students as they undergo the kind of careful reading the Common Core State Standards require. Each of these exemplars features the following: i) readings tasks in which students are asked to read and reread passages and respond to a series of text dependent questions; 2) vocabulary and syntax tasks which linger over noteworthy or challenging words and phrases; 3) discussion tasks in which students are prompted to use text evidence and refine their thinking; and 4) writing tasks that assess student understanding of the text."

TEXT COMPLEXITY Educational Leadership:Reading: The Core Skill:The Challenge of Challen... - 0 views

  •  
    "When teachers understand what makes texts complex, they can better support their students in reading them. How is reading complex text like lifting weights? Just as it's impossible to build muscle without weight or resistance, it's impossible to build robust reading skills without reading challenging text. The common core state standards in language arts treat text difficulty as akin to weight or resistance in an exercise program. This is in contrast to most past discussion of this topic, which emphasized how overly complex text may impede learning. Such discussion therefore focused on developing various readability schemes and text gradients to help teachers determine which books might be too hard for their students. The new standards instead propose that teachers move students purposefully through increasingly complex text to build skill and stamina."

The Hart-Risley 30 Million Word Gap Study - 1995 « Language Fix - 0 views

  •  
    "After decades of collaborating to increase child language vocabulary, Betty Hart and Todd Risley spent 2 1/2 years intensely observing the language of 42 families throughout Kansas City. Specifically, they looked at household language use in three different settings: 1) professional families; 2) working class; 3) welfare families. "
